你查询的IP:[123.101.28.36]  地理位置:中国–河南–郑州

最新查询119.176.170.136 59.191.43.216 221.136.77.59 202.122.175.109 58.66.126.155 119.40.35.127 122.48.36.152 221.14.27.251 221.130.216.204 123.101.28.36 222.16.1.41 203.90.201.71 116.255.128.168 119.27.192.240 117.60.248.125 123.96.17.221 202.75.208.188 116.196.177.7 203.91.32.23 202.10.64.203 124.112.121.249 203.119.24.146 221.208.241.139 124.64.118.190 121.52.208.255 203.92.69.180 134.196.185.173 120.64.233.130 117.48.85.189 122.200.64.168 202.95.7.198